Classic Blueberry Pancakes
Traditional dish · American
Fluffy, golden-brown pancakes studded with fresh blueberries, offering a delightful burst of fruity flavor in every bite. A timeless breakfast favorite.
Ingredients
- All-purpose flour2 cups
- Granulated sugar2 tablespoons
- Baking powder2 teaspoons
- Salt1/2 teaspoon
- Milk1 3/4 cups
- Large egg1
- Unsalted butter, melted2 tablespoons
- Fresh blueberries1 cup
- Vegetable oil or butter, for griddleas needed
Steps
- 1
In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t.
- 2
In a separate bowl, whisk together the milk, egg, and melted butter.
- 3
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ir until just combined. Do not overmix; a few lumps are okay.
- 4
Gently fold in the fresh blueberries.
- 5
Heat a lightly oiled griddle or frying pan over medium-high heat.
- 6
Pour or scoop the batter onto the griddle, using approximately 1/4 cup for each pancake.
- 7
Cook for about 2-3 minutes per side, or until golden brown and cooked through. Flip when bubbles appear on the surface.
- 8
Serve immediately with your favorite toppings like butter, syrup, or extra berries.
